Catchline at repeal: Notice of filing settlement. History: Repealed 1976 (1st Extra. Sess.) Ky. Acts ch. 14, sec. 491, effective January 2, 1978. -- Amended 1966 Ky. Acts ch. 239, sec. 1. -- Created 1942 Ky. Acts ch. 167, sec. 14.

Notes of Decisions
Cited in 2 cases, 1949–1958 · leading case: Kentucky Trust Co. v. Sweeney, 163 F. Supp. 450 (W.D. Ky. 1958).
Kentucky Trust Co. v. Sweeney, 163 F. Supp. 450 (W.D. Ky. 1958). “Sufficiency of notice of the settlement under KRS 25.195 is not contested here and such notice is in itself notice that the trustee’s compensation will be awarded.”
